The bustling village of lower Solva has lots to offer - restaurants, pubs, shops, galleries, supplies, Restaurants, Pubs and Fresh Crab: Five minutes walk away is the village store and off-licence (open everyday 8 till late) here you can buy most essentials, it also has a Post Office section (norm. opening hours). New automated fresh local milk distribution point. The farm shop Penpant is 1.5 km away for fresh fruit and veg.

St.Davids has a good supermarket (delicious fresh bread baked throughout the day) and a lovely delicatessence. The closest large town, Haverfordwest has umpteen supermarkets, some providing on-line order. There is a local catering service that will provide wonderful meals as and when you require them.

In the village, four local pubs all provide excellent food in addition to the three restaurants that cater for those 'special' evenings. DOWN ON THE QUAI there is a licenced tea-room for snacks and sandwiches and, if you are lucky, you might manage to persuade a fisherman to part with some of his catch.
Just up the road from the cottage you can buy superb DRESSED-CRAB and lobster... an absolute MUST before you leave.
